【问题标题】:SparkR Error: The root scratch dir: /tmp/hive on HDFS should be writableSparkR 错误:根暂存目录:HDFS 上的 /tmp/hive 应该是可写的
【发布时间】:2018-06-01 21:07:31
【问题描述】:

我正在尝试初始化 SparkR,但出现权限错误。我的 Spark 版本是 spark-2.2.1-bin-hadoop2.6。我已经搜索了这个错误以及如何解决它,我找到了几个相关的主题。但是,我无法使用与这些主题中相同的方法来解决它,他们提供的解决方案(以及我尝试过的解决方案)是使用以下命令授予 /tmp/hive 目录的权限:

sudo -u hdfs hadoop fs -chmod -R 777 /tmp/hive

有足够知识的人可以给我另一个可能的解决方案吗?

【解决方案1】:

由于您的错误权限与文件系统的输出不匹配,听起来您下载了Spark但没有配置它,因此它默认为本地磁盘

首先,尝试从 CDH 安装中单独使用spark-shell 来运行烟雾测试。

我认为 Cloudera 包括 SparkR(他们只是没有正式支持它)。我看不出他们为什么要从安装中删除它。

我的 Spark 版本是 spark-2.2.1-bin-hadoop2.6。

您下载了包含 hadoop 的版本(基于文件名的结尾)。既然你说你在集群上设置了它,你应该使用没有预编译 Hadoop 的下载选项。除非它实际上是 Cloudera 包裹,否则不要将其放在 /opt/cloudera/parcels 目录中。

然后,一旦你有了它,把它解压到某个地方,然后打开 conf/spark-env.sh(将模板复制到这个文件中)

更新这些值以至少包含与 CDH 附带的其他 Spark 安装相同的信息

确保HADOOP_CONF_DIR 指向您系统上Hadoop 的配置目录。 /etc/hadoop/conf/
